New Orleans, LASummaryThe Assistant / Associate Athletic Director of Athletic Communications leads the Athletic Communications team. This position promotes and enhances the image of the Tulane University Department of Intercollegiate Athletics through media relations, public relations, social media, and web communications. This position serves as the point person for comprehensive integrated communications and marketing strategies.Required Knowledge, Skills, and AbilitiesStrong interpersonal skillsStrong writing skillsAbility to interact effectively with coaches, administrators, student athletes, and vendorsExtremely organized, self-starter, intrinsically motivatedStrong organizational, management, and leadership skillsProficient computer skills including word processing, HTML, and social mediaProven ability to multi-task effectivelyAbility to prioritize assignments and meet deadlinesAvailable to work flexible work schedule including nights and weekendsAbility to travel with sport teams for away contestsThorough knowledge of NCAA and American Conference rules and regulationsNCAA Related :
